Is it better for balls to be cold or hot?
Temperature is Critical The testicles need to be four degrees cooler than body temperature to make plenty of healthy sperm. The cremaster muscle contracts to pull the testicles closer to the body if they start to get too cold, and it relaxes to push them farther from the body to cool off if they get too warm.

Is warm sperm healthy?
Heat. Testes need to be a few degrees cooler than the rest of the body to make good quality sperm. This is why they sit in the scrotum which acts like an ‘evaporative air conditioning system’, at a lower temperature than the rest of the body. If it gets too hot around the testes, they can have problems making sperm.

Does heat reduce sperm count?
Abstract. In humans, as in most mammals, spermatogenesis is temperature dependent. This temperature dependence has been clearly demonstrated by several experimental studies showing that artificial increases in scrotum or testicle temperature in fertile men reduce both sperm output and quality.

Which sperm is good thick or thin?
Normally, semen is a thick, whitish liquid. However, several conditions can change the color and consistency of semen. Watery semen can be a sign of low sperm count, indicating possible fertility problems. Ejaculating thin, clear semen may also be a temporary condition with no serious health concerns.
